10 Years Of “Janji Joni” : a Retrospective

in 2005, a well known moviemaker Joko Anwar set a groundbreaking in Indonesian movie industry through his movie debut Janji Joni. Even this movie has not peaked box office in local, Janji Joni gains positive feedback from criticus and movie enthusiast which undoubtedly stated that Joko Anwar is a genius moviemaker.

Janji Joni itsef is a simple story about film roll courier, Joni (Nicholas Saputra) who has ordinary daily life and one day he meets with mysterious woman named Angelique (Mariana Renata) and she requested Joni to do his job on time so they can become acquainted closer with each other.

In my perspective, Janji Joni is a few of Indonesian movie that has cool “explaining” part. In Janji Joni, audience will explained by narrator (Nicholas Saputra himself) further about who is Joni, what is he do, what the circumstances in his job and anything that make people who not know really about cinema and movie industry become familiar and eventually could enjoy the movie. That is the basic factors that often forgotten by other directors that tend to treated explanation part just for gimmicks and not really relate with other scene in their movie.

Then in Janji Joni everything is served just the way it is, Janji Joni vividly shows the doubts of movie critics, and Joko Anwar as director apparently not hesitate to show kissing scenes in this movie in proportional way that not downgraded the content to become B rated movie.

As the urban comedy movie, Janji Joni set new standard, coupled with philosophically funny quotes also with numerous stars that become cameo (Wulan Guritno, Ananda Mikola, Surya Saputra, Tora Sudiro, Indra Birowo, Rachel Maryam, even legendary actor Barry Prima, etc) this movie are still irreplaceable with other movie in this genre.
